    480mm Apo-Ronar

    Gentlemen, I'm looking for a bit of information. I have a 480mm/19" Apo-Ronar on the way and I wonder what size the filter thread is. The lens is marked up for apertures on one side (f9-f260) but it's engraved in red the other side and marked 2-50mm. Any ideas what this is about. Thanks for any help.

    Re: 480mm Apo-Ronar

    The last Apo-Ronar 480mm has a filter thread of M 67 x 0.75mm.

    The mm-scale shows the mechanical diameter of the iris diaphragm. Wide open it should be 53.33mm.
